Message-ID: <2025111239-CVE-2025-40161-8d13@gregkh> Date: Wed, 12 Nov 2025 19:24:42 +0900 From: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@...uxfoundation.org> To: linux-cve-announce@...r.kernel.org Cc: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@...nel.org> Subject: CVE-2025-40161: mailbox: zynqmp-ipi: Fix SGI cleanup on unbind From: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@...nel.org> Description =========== In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: mailbox: zynqmp-ipi: Fix SGI cleanup on unbind The driver incorrectly determines SGI vs SPI interrupts by checking IRQ number < 16, which fails with dynamic IRQ allocation. During unbind, this causes improper SGI cleanup leading to kernel crash. Add explicit irq_type field to pdata for reliable identification of SGI interrupts (type-2) and only clean up SGI resources when appropriate. The Linux kernel CVE team has assigned CVE-2025-40161 to this issue. Affected and fixed versions =========================== Issue introduced in 6.10 with commit 6ffb1635341bec50fa9540ae7827d1e5d75ae0b0 and fixed in 6.12.54 with commit 1ee147efee68be00203b1fee6479911debb1edb2 Issue introduced in 6.10 with commit 6ffb1635341bec50fa9540ae7827d1e5d75ae0b0 and fixed in 6.17.4 with commit 32bf7c6e01f5ba17a53ba236a770bd0274cefdf4 Issue introduced in 6.10 with commit 6ffb1635341bec50fa9540ae7827d1e5d75ae0b0 and fixed in 6.18-rc1 with commit bb160e791ab15b89188a7a19589b8e11f681bef3 Please see https://www.kernel.org for a full list of currently supported kernel versions by the kernel community. Unaffected versions might change over time as fixes are backported to older supported kernel versions. The official CVE entry at https://cve.org/CVERecord/?id=CVE-2025-40161 will be updated if fixes are backported, please check that for the most up to date information about this issue. Affected files ============== The file(s) affected by this issue are: drivers/mailbox/zynqmp-ipi-mailbox.c Mitigation ========== The Linux kernel CVE team recommends that you update to the latest stable kernel version for this, and many other bugfixes.
